Specifications

32

Specifications

EM 500

RF characteristics

Modulation

wideband FM

Receiving frequency ranges

516–558, 566–608, 626–668, 734–776,
780–822, 823–865 MHz (A to E, G, see page 4)

Receiving frequencies

1,680 frequencies, tuneable in steps of 25 kHz

20 frequency banks, each with up to 32 factory-preset
channels, intermodulation-free

6 frequency banks, each with up to 32 user programmable
channels

Switching bandwidth

42 MHz

Nominal/peak deviation

±

24 kHz/

±

48 kHz

Receiver principle

true diversity

Sensitivity (with

HDX

, peak deviation)

<

2 μV for 52 dBA

rms S/N

Adjacent channel rejection

typ.

75 dB

Intermodulation attenuation

typ.

70 dB

Blocking

75 dB

Squelch

Off, 5 to 25 dB

μ

V in steps of 2 dB

Pilot tone squelch

can be switched off

Antenna inputs

2 BNC sockets

AF characteristics

Compander system

Sennheiser

HDX

EQ presets (switchable,
affect the line and monitor outputs):

Preset 1: “

Flat

Preset 2: “

Low Cut

–3 dB at 180 Hz

Preset 3: “

Low Cut/High Boost

–3 dB at 180 Hz
+6 dB at 10 kHz

Preset 3: “

High Boost

+6 dB at 10 kHz

S/N ratio (1 mV, peak deviation)

115 dBA

THD

0.9%

AF output voltage
(at peak deviation, 1 kHz AF)

¼’’ (6.3 mm) jack socket (unbalanced): +12 dBu
XLR socket (balanced): +18 dBu

Adjustment range of audio output level

48 dB (in steps of 3 dB)
+6 dB gain reserve

Overall device

Temperature range

–10°C to

+

55°C

Power supply

12 V

Current consumption

350 mA

Dimensions

approx. 202 x 212 x 43 mm

Weight

approx. 980 g
